About A. Talukder

A. Talukder is a scholar working on Structural Biology,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Automotive Engineering, Environmental Engineering and Computer Networks and Communications, having authored 22 papers that have together received 682 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Autonomous Vehicle Technology and Safety (3 papers), Neural Networks and Applications (3 papers), Energy Efficient Wireless Sensor Networks (3 papers), Robotics and Sensor-Based Localization (3 papers), Robotic Path Planning Algorithms (2 papers), Microstructure and mechanical properties (2 papers), Distributed Sensor Networks and Detection Algorithms (2 papers) and Water Quality Monitoring Technologies (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(466 citations), Aerospace Engineering (313 citations), Automotive Engineering (114 citations), Environmental Engineering (71 citations) and Geology (19 citations). A. Talukder has collaborated with scholars based in United States and India. Frequent co-authors include Larry Matthies, Roberto Manduchi, A. Castaño, Arturo Rankin, Adnan Ansar, David Casasent, K. Owens, Rebecca Castaño, Thomas F. Schatzki and Adam Morawiec. Their work appears in journals such as Microscopy and Microanalysis, Autonomous Robots, Ultramicroscopy, International Journal of Engineering and Advanced Technology and ScholarsArchive (Brigham Young University).
